About

Marcello Moccia is a scholar working on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Neurology and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Marcello Moccia has authored 171 papers receiving a total of 3.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 95 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ine, 68 papers in Neurology and 21 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Marcello Moccia’s work include Multiple Sclerosis Research Studies (95 papers),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(38 papers) and Neurological disorders and treatments (23 papers). Marcello Moccia is often cited by papers focused on Multiple Sclerosis Research Studies (95 papers),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(38 papers) and Neurological disorders and treatments (23 papers). Marcello Moccia coll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United Kingdom and United States. Marcello Moccia's co-authors include Roberto Erro, Paolo Barone, Carmine Vitale, Marina Picillo, Maria Teresa Pellecchia, Marianna Amboni, Roberta Lanzillo, Gabriella Santangelo, Katia Longo and Antonio Carotenuto and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, NeuroImage and Neurology.
